Output cfc6114e901aeef64bc0ecfe274b8ea7d62f258037418f7b59bdabdc4cc5beb0:0

value
27726
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3ab8cb63dc77f67c8a78bc3fa6a849856d6c70e23659789332e3c9bd522b983
address
bc1pcw4ced3acalk0j9830pl565ynptdd3cwydje0zfn9c7fh4fzhxpsrhz25e
transaction
cfc6114e901aeef64bc0ecfe274b8ea7d62f258037418f7b59bdabdc4cc5beb0
confirmations
109058
spent
true